What You’ll Do You’ll serve as an expert in simulation-based education, creating meaningful, hands-on learning experiences that prepare students for real-world clinical practice.

In this role, you will

Facilitate dynamic simulation experiences using Healthcare Simulation Standards of Best Practice™ Lead prebriefing and debriefing sessions that promote reflection, critical thinking, and clinical reasoning Partner with faculty and simulation leaders to design and enhance curriculum-based scenarios Mentor and support students in developing clinical judgment and identifying growth opportunities Deliver thoughtful, constructive feedback that builds confidence and competence Collaborate with simulation operations staff to ensure seamless, high-quality learning environments Integrate advanced technologies such as high-fidelity simulators, virtual reality, and electronic charting systems Support interprofessional education and innovative teaching strategies Contribute to simulation center goals, accreditation efforts, and continuous improvement initiatives Who You Are You’re an educator at heart with a passion for innovation, collaboration, and student success. Requirements

What You Bring Master’s Degree in Nursing (required) Active Registered Nurse (RN) license in Utah (required) CHSE certification (or willingness to obtain within 36 months) 2+ years of simulation education or management experience (preferred) Strong knowledge of simulation pedagogy, debriefing techniques, and adult learning principles Ob and/or Peds experience is a plus What to Expect Schedule: Part-Time (Less than 30 hours per week), Monday–Friday (with occasional evenings or Saturdays) Location: Draper, Utah campus Environment: Hands-on simulation labs with advanced clinical technology Why Joyce University At Joyce, we invest in you—because when our people thrive, our students do too.
